We are seeking an experienced IT Event Administrator to join our dynamic team at TEG Pty Ltd.

About the Company

TEG connects fans to unforgettable experiences and businesses to their audiences through our portfolio of iconic brands across 40 countries.

Job Description

The successful candidate will be responsible for providing on-site IT support, managing ticketing systems, and coordinating the installation of I.T. collateral at various event locations throughout Australia.

Responsibilities
  • Ensure seamless IT operations at events
  • Configure and maintain ticketing systems, POS devices, and other infrastructure
  • Carry out routine maintenance tasks on internal and external client equipment and infrastructure
  • Document all changes made to network or device configuration
  • Respond promptly to IT support calls and log fault information in the service desk database system
Requirements
  • A minimum of 3 years' experience in a technical or support specialist role
  • Experience working with ticketing systems, preferably in live events
  • Proven ability to work efficiently under pressure, prioritizing tasks and meeting deadlines
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ills
  • Familiarity with Windows, server administration, and Cisco networking would be highly beneficial
